What You’ll Do

- Design and produce customer-facing digital and eCommerce creative, including emails, homepage assets, banners, promotional graphics, and related campaign materials.
- Translate marketing briefs, copy, photography, and campaign direction into polished, accurate layouts.
- Participate in project pickup and kickoff conversations to understand creative requirements, timelines, deliverables, and marketing objectives.
- Ask questions and proactively resolve missing or conflicting information before beginning production.
- Create and revise layouts in Figma while ensuring work follows established creative and brand guidelines.
- Work with product photography, copy, typography, and graphic elements to create clear, engaging promotional creative.
- Adapt approved creative across multiple sizes, formats, channels, and campaign requirements.
- Incorporate stakeholder feedback and complete revisions accurately and efficiently.
- Support additional campaign materials such as flyers, catalogues, booklets, and other promotional assets as required.




- Prepare finished graphic elements and support English and French creative versions when needed.
- Manage multiple projects and deadlines in a fast-moving retail marketing environment.
- Ensure final creative meets technical, production, and quality standards.

What You’ll Bring

- 4+ years of professional graphic or digital design experience.
- Robust hands-on experience designing for eCommerce and digital marketing channels.
- A portfolio demonstrating work across assets such as email, homepage creative, web banners, landing pages, or comparable digital campaign experiences.
- Strong proficiency with Figma and experience using it for hands-on design and production.
- Proficiency with relevant Adobe Creative Suite tools, particularly Photoshop and Illustrator.
- Strong layout, typography, visual hierarchy, and image-composition skills.
- Experience taking creative or marketing direction and translating it into finished design.
- Ability to manage multiple assignments, revisions, and deadlines without sacrificing accuracy.
- Strong attention to detail and commitment to producing polished, production-ready work.
- Comfortable collaborating with marketing, creative, production, and other cross-functional partners.
- Ability to receive feedback, adapt quickly, and keep projects moving.

What Will Set You Apart

- Previous retail, eCommerce, direct-to-consumer, consumer-brand, or agency experience.
- Experience designing high-volume promotional or seasonal campaigns.
- Motion design experience.
- Experience with After Effects or comparable motion tools.




- Experience adapting campaigns across both digital and print channels.
- Experience supporting bilingual English/French creative production.
